Mr. Braj Kishore Prasad, APP 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E DR. JUSTICE RAVI RANJAN ORAL ORDER 06-10-2018 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ned A.P.P. for the State.

The petitioner seeks bail in a case registered for offences punishable under Section 30 (a) of the Bihar Prohibition and Excise Act, 2016.

It is contended that, as per allegation, 1350 litres foreign liquor were recovered from a Pick Up Van which was being boarded by two persons including the petitioner. Petitioner is claimed to be driver of the aforesaid Van. It is urged that the petitioner has falsely been implicated in this case merely on suspicion as he had no knowledge about the seized illegal liquor. Petitioner claims that he is having clean antecedent and is in custody since 09.07.2018.

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.59342 of 2018(2) dt.06-10-2018 2/2 Having regard to the facts and the circumstances of the case, the abovenamed petitioner is directed to be released on bail on his fur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-(Rupees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the ADJ II-Cum- Special Judge, Gopalganj in connection with Excise Case No. 153 of 2018. Further, if the petitioner, after his release in this case, is again found to be involved in similar nature of case then the court concerned would be at liberty to take steps for cancellation of his bail bond.
